Highlight.js

语法高亮
授权协议 BSD
开发语言 JavaScript
所属分类 Web应用开发、 语法着色和高亮
软件类型 开源软件
地区 不详
投 递 者 齐昊苍
操作系统 跨平台
开源组织
适用人群 未知
 软件概览

highlight.js是一个用于在任何web页面上着色显示各种示例源代码语法的JS项目。具有以下特色:

  • 支持 92 种语言,49 种代码格式化风格。

  • 自动检测语言种类

  • 支持多语言混合的代码高亮

  • 支持Node.js

  • 支持使用任何HTML标记

  • 兼容任意js框架

  • 基本用法​ 在浏览器中使用​ 在网页上使用highlight.js的最小限度是链接到一个主题库并调用highlightAll: <link rel="stylesheet" href="//cdnjs.cloudflare.com/ajax/libs/highlight.js/11.6.0/styles/default.min.css"> <script src="//cdnjs.cloudfla

  • 用法 <link rel="stylesheet" href="../../assets/highlight/styles/default.css"> <script type="text/javascript" charset="UTF-8" src="../../assets/highlight/highligh

  • 简介 highlight.js 作为 hljs 对象的方法提供一些函数。 highlight(name, value, ignore_illegals, continuation) 用指定语言高亮代码。 参数: name : 要高亮的语言名,或别名 value : 原始 HTML 字符串 ignore_illegals : 是否忽略非法字符 continuation : 是否继续未完成的解析 返回

  • Highlight.js Highlight.js是用JavaScript编写的 语法突出显示工具。 github, 它在浏览器和服务器上均可使用。 它几乎可以与任何标记一起使用,不依赖任何框架,并且具有自动语言检测功能。 Vue中使用highlight.js格式化高亮代码 1.安装 npm install highlight.js --save //默认导入将导入所有语言 2.引入 impo

  • 1、引入highlight.js npm install highlight.js 2、 在main.js中引入 // 引入 highlight.js 代码高亮工具 import hljs from "highlight.js"; // 使用样式,有多种样式可选 import "highlight.js/styles/github-gist.css"; // 增加自定义命令v-highlight

 相关资料
  • 本文向大家介绍JavaScript语法高亮插件highlight.js用法详解【附highlight.js本站下载】 原创,包括了JavaScript语法高亮插件highlight.js用法详解【附highlight.js本站下载】 原创的使用技巧和注意事项,需要的朋友参考一下 本文实例讲述了JavaScript语法高亮库highlight.js用法。分享给大家供大家参考,具体如下: highli

  • 目前我们已经为Potion文件实现了简单的关键字和函数的语法高亮。 如果没有做上一章的练习,你需要回去完成。我将假设你做了练习。 事实上,你应该回去完成你跳过的任何练习。即使你觉得你不需要,为了更好的学习效果, 你都得把它们完成了。请在这一点上相信我。 高亮注释 接下来我们需要高亮Potion的一个重要组成部分——注释。 问题是,Potion的注释以#开头,而#并不在iskeyword里。 如果不

  • 我们甚至可以为Vim里面的语法高亮另开一本书了。 我们将在此讲解它最后的重要内容,然后继续讲别的东西。 如果你想要学到更多,去读:help syntax并阅读别人写的syntax文件。 高亮字符串 Potion,一如大多数编程语言,支持诸如"Hello,world!"的字符串字面量。 我们应该把这些高亮成字符串。为此我们将使用syntax region命令。 在你的Potion syntax文件中

  • Highlight.js 是一个可以给 pre 标签中的代码高亮的插件,highlightjs 不依赖于第三方 js 库,支持上百种语言高亮和几十种样式风格,它可以自动检测语言,完美兼容各种框架。

  • 简单示例 https://github.com/odinserj/Hangfire.Highlighter 完整示例 http://highlighter.hangfire.io, sources Table of Contents 概述 配置项目 先决条件 创建项目 代码语法高亮 问题 解决问题 安装 Hangfire 转到后台处理 结论 概述 假设您正在构建一个代码仓库的 Web 应用程序,如

  • 既然已经移除前进路上的绊脚石,是时候开始为我们的Potion插件写下一些有用的代码。 我们将从一些简单的语法高亮开始。 在你的插件的repo中创建syntax/potion.vim。把下面的代码放到你的文件里: :::vim if exists("b:current_syntax") finish endif echom "Our syntax highlighting code wil